Jimmy Buffett At Fenway Park Event Guide

Fenway Park turns into Margaritaville Thursday night.

BOSTON, MA — Margaritaville has been moved from the Xfinity Center in Mansfield to Fenway Park for 2018.

Jimmy Buffett brings the "Down The Rabbit Hole Tour" to the home of the Boston Red Sox Thursday night. The show will be his first return to the ballpark since he played two shows there in 2004. Joining Buffett will be Peter Wolf and The Midnight Travelers and Caroline Jones.

Getting to Fenway Park

There are several parking lots in the Fenway, Kenmore, and Back Bay neighborhoods with various prices. If you take a car into the city, be prepared to pay anywhere between $40-65 for parking and allow for plenty of time around the area.

You can also take the MBTA Green Line. All trains but those on the E Line stop at Kenmore and the D Line trains stop at Fenway as well. Both stops are a short walk away from the ballpark.

Fans on the Framingham/Worcester Line can access Fenway Park from the Yawkey Station, which is across the street.

The Bag Rule

As stated on the Fenway Park website, no bag or item larger than 16"x16"x8" will be permitted. Hard-sided coolers and glass containers are not allowed.
